【问题标题】:Database application with C#使用 C# 的数据库应用程序
【发布时间】:2010-08-30 22:53:02
【问题描述】:

这是我第一个使用数据库的应用程序。我正在使用 SQLite 和 Visual Studio。我添加了数据库,但如何存储和检索信息?我使用 System.Data.SQLite 作为 .NET 包装器。

包装器显然为我提供了创建连接和执行查询的方法,但有没有更简单的方法来做到这一点?是否有其他可用的库可以使其变得更容易?

如果没有更简单的方法,有人可以指点我为 SQLite(或一般的 SQL)提供一个体面的教程的方向吗?主要是关于如何有效地构建我的表以及如何编写查询来存储和检索数据的教程,特别是在 C# 中尽可能使用这个包装器。

谢谢!

【问题讨论】:

    标签: c# database sqlite system.data.sqlite


    【解决方案1】:

    System.Data.Sqlite 包含在 Visual Studio 中启用设计时支持的选项,因此您可以使用服务器资源管理器在 IDE 中查看您的 Sqlite 数据库。

    另一个有用的工具是免费的 Sqlite2009 Pro,http://osenxpsuite.net/?xp=3&uid=managementtools

    您还应该查看 System.Data.Sqlite 帮助文件,作者在其中讨论了事务的重要性。他有一个很好的例子,它还展示了如何使用using 语句来创建命令和事务。

    【讨论】:

      【解决方案2】:

      如果没有更简单的方法,可以 有人请指点我 一个体面的教程的方向 SQLite(或一般的 SQL)?

      http://sqlzoo.net/

      【讨论】:

      • ...如果您想使用低级方法,这是一个很好的起点,为什么不使用 System.Data.SQLite 提供的 ADO.NET 连接器的优势呢?跨度>
      【解决方案3】:

      这里有一个关于 SQL Lite 的教程http://www.eggheadcafe.com/articles/20040714.asp 和 ado.net。

      【讨论】:

        猜你喜欢
        • 1970-01-01
        • 1970-01-01
        • 2014-09-30
        • 2015-11-25
        • 1970-01-01
        • 1970-01-01
        • 1970-01-01
        • 1970-01-01
        • 1970-01-01
        相关资源
        最近更新 更多